Fading Obscurities is a short story mission in Borg Arc 4 of Star Trek Fleet Command. It auto-starts, asks for level 1 and a single warp, and sends you home to see the aftermath of the Borg invasion. One objective, no combat, no branching. Finishing it pays 34,000 Parsteel and 1,000 Dilithium and moves you on to the next mission in the arc.

Fading Obscurities rewards
Completing the mission gives 34,000 Parsteel and 1,000 Dilithium. Parsteel is the resource you spend most on building upgrades and ship construction through the early and middle game, so a 34,000 lump helps fund whatever you are building next. Dilithium is scarcer and feeds research and higher-tier upgrade costs, which makes the 1,000 payout the more valuable half of the reward for most commanders. Clearing Fading Obscurities also advances Borg Arc 4 and opens the following mission, The Graveyard of Giants.
